제목 ❙Effects of an Aquatic Exercise Program on Pulmonary Function, Muscle Strength, and Balance in Women Aged 50 and Older

Abstract This study examined the effects of an aquatic exercise program on pulmonary function, muscle strength, and balance in women aged 50 years and older. Methods: Thirty-two women over the age of 50 were assigned to either an aquatic exercise group(n=16) or a control group(n=16). The aquatic exercise group participated in a 6-week aquatic exercise program consisting of two 60-minute sessions per week, including aerobic, resistance, and balance training components. The control group received no structured exercise intervention during the study period and was instructed to maintain their usual daily activities. Outcome measures included grip strength, knee extensor strength, 10-second sit-to-stand test(10sSTS), timed up and go test(TUG), and pulmonary function parameters(FVC, FEV1, FEV1/FVC, and PEF). Results: Significant improvements were observed in the aquatic exercise group for knee extensor strength (p=.000), TUG (p=.000), and PEF(p=.002) following the intervention. Two-way mixed ANOVA revealed significant group × time interaction effects for knee extensor strength(F=50.349, p<.001, partial η²=.627), TUG(F=5.649, p=.024, partial η²=.158), and PEF(F=10.299, p=.003, partial η²=.256), indicating greater improvements in the aquatic exercise group compared with the control group. No significant interaction or main effects were observed for grip strength, 10sSTS, FVC, FEV1, or FEV1/FVC(p>.05). Conclusion: The aquatic exercise program significantly improved lower limb strength, functional mobility, and peak expiratory flow in women aged 50 years and older. These findings suggest that aquatic exercise can be a safe and effective way to improve lower extremity function and respiratory performance in middle-aged and older women.
